**Ticket: Nightly partner feed rejected — signature mismatch on SFTP drop**

Context for you: our partner Bramleigh Mutual drops encrypted settlement files to our SFTP landing zone each night, and our ingest job verifies a detached signature before processing. Last night's verification failed because our trust store still holds their expired public key; the file itself appears intact. Please import the replacement key, re-run verification on last night's drop, and confirm ingest succeeds. The current verification key follows.

release key, fajef-kajeg: bky19_LdLu6Ne6FLi8he2c24d

The waveform preview in Tonefield ships behind the `wave_preview` flag and must be enabled region by region. Release candidates should verify peak rendering on mono, stereo, and long-form fixtures before sign-off. The verification checklist, fixture locations, and rollback procedure are documented on the internal release page linked below.

operations page: https://jenkins.zemvarcloud.local/job/merge_requests/repo/build/73930b4b30f0a8ed

Runbook: Relevance tuning — SeekPort search. If customers report odd ranking after a tuning push, first check whether the active profile matches the posted tuning notes in the Lintbury wiki space. Do not roll back synonyms yourself; file to the relevance rotation instead. Known quirk: boosted categories can take up to 30 minutes to propagate, so confirm the timestamp before escalating. When escalating, include the query, expected result, and the index snapshot in use. The currently deployed tuning bundle is identified by the token below.

pipeline stamp: htk31_f769b577b3028a4e9958e5bb8d1259a